Output 385dc7311288045d68d7a267c5e81ead2e1263c6f98562bc4d840c25de649f6c:28

value
1061938489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f589d22c0a050cfc84c38c37e21284ccda2ba8b8 OP_EQUALVERIFY OP_CHECKSIG
address
LhcEvBUJRjh8SQDQx3HV5FktZnPrha35br
transaction
385dc7311288045d68d7a267c5e81ead2e1263c6f98562bc4d840c25de649f6c
spent
true